Mrs. Mary A. Chambers, 81, widow of Henry F. Chambers, passed away about 11:30 o'clock Tuesday night at the home of her son-in-law and daughter. Dr. and Mrs, Henry A. Romberg, 1354 Plummer avenue, Death was due to infirmities incident to her advanced age.

The deceased was born Aug. 26, 1866, in Pennsylvania, daughter of the late Mr. and Mrs. Carl Schumann. On Jan. 27. 1887. she was married here to Henry F. Chambers, who preceded her in death in 1924,

She was a member of Tenth Street Methodist church and was a charter member of the Women's Society of Christian Service of that church. She had formerly lived at 719 Ninth street for many year, and for the last four and a half years resided at 1354 Plummer avenue.

Survivors are one daughter, Mrs. Vivian F. Romberg, wife of Dr. Henry A. Romberg; one brother, Otto Schumann; two sisters, Mrs. Minnie Neff and Mrs. J. J, Baranowski; four grandchildren, Mary Elizabeth, Daniel, Ellen Ann and Steven Romberg, all of this city. One sister and four brothers preceded her in death.

Funeral services will be held Friday afternoon at 2 o'clock at the Marquardt funeral home. The Rev. Marlin E. Smith will officiate. Interment will take place at Riverside cemetery. Friends may call to view the remains Thursday afternoon and up to the time of the service at the funeral home.

The Oshkosh Northwestern
Oshkosh, Wisconsin
18 Feb 1948, Wed • Page 4
